The Laine Store

According to Wikipedia the Laine Store at 996 Elizabeth Street was run by the Tilden family from 1865 to 1912. In the 1920's it became a Chinese gambling hall and has a sorted history ever since. It is now just a ghost of its former self lying next to the railroad tracks. Nikon D70 and a Tokina 11-16 mm f2.8 lens. This is a three shot exposure merged in Photomatrix Pro. Base exposure is f/11 at 1.0 sec. [#17305]
